Friday, June 20, 2025

Malankara Catholic News Network

423162171_776083811211862_5535661804403115839_n

423223033_775621001258143_5082031744339140252_n
422937185_774966101323633_4987672588724696580_n

Most Read

error: Content copying is prohibited.